<el-select v-model="scope.row.payChannel"
placeholder="请选择支付方式"
@change="() => {
payChange(scope.row);
}">
<el-option v-for="(item, index) in options" :key="index" :label="item.label"
:value="item.value" :disabled="isSelect(item.value)" />
</el-select>
const isSelect = (val: any) => {
return tableData.value.some((item: any) => item.payChannel === val);
};
文章描述了如何在Vue应用中使用el-select组件,通过v-model绑定数据,当用户选择支付方式时触发change事件,并利用isSelect函数检查当前选项是否已在tableData中存在。

2万+

被折叠的 条评论
为什么被折叠?



